JeffandJade Posted September 29, 2004 Report Share Posted September 29, 2004 The fastest way into Shenzhen is through Huang Gong border. You can buy a bus ticket outside arrival hall A in Hong Kong airport for 100HKD. Bus takes about an hour and a half - then you can get a taxi from the border into Shenzhen. Takes about 2 hours instead of 3-4 going through Lo Wu. Plus you dont have to fight the crowd on the train. JeffandJade Posted September 29, 2004 Report Share Posted September 29, 2004 If your flight gets into Hong Kong early enough you can take the ferry boat. I think the last one leaves at 7:00pm (they dont run it at night). My United Airlines flight gets in at 6:05pm so after customs I dont have time to catch the ferry. But if your flight gets in before 5pm the ferry is the fastest route. Although, it takes you to Sherko which is about an hour from down town Shenzhen. Jeff Link to comment

corvette Posted September 29, 2004 Report Share Posted September 29, 2004 Any one with information on best way to get either to Guangzhou or Nanning from Hong Kong - Shenzen would be appreaciated. I would recommend the connecting flight or the shuttle bus. I'm not sure about the price for a connecting flight from HK to other places, but if we buy it in GZ it will only cost for about 1k RMB for a round trip. Shuttle bus is convinient too, because there are lots of them at the airport and they run every 15 mins. But going through the customs was really great pain. You will have to wait in long queue, and it usually take double or triple time at weekends than normal working days. If you do not have lots of luggages, shuttle bus may not be a bad choice. But since there are always loads of buses at the customs, make sure you remember the bus plate No. The whole trip from HK airport to GZ will take 3-4 hours, depending on the number of ppl going through customs. Cory took a connecting flight from HK to GZ when he came see me 2 weeks ago. It cost more but it was much more convenient. You may check some HK travel agencies, they may have some good deals on flights to and from mainland China. Link to comment
